On July 4, Sensex dropped by 170.22 points, closing at 83,239.47. The Nifty also fell by 48.10 points, finishing at 25,405.30. About 1,947 shares advanced, –1,912 shares declined, and 154 shares remained unchanged.
Top Nifty gainers: Apollo Hospitals, Hero MotoCorp, Dr Reddy’s Labs, ONGC, Maruti Suzuki
Top Nifty Losers : SBI Life Insurance, Kotak Mahindra Bank, Bajaj Finance, JSW Steel, Bajaj Finserv.
On the sectoral front, metal, realty, PSU Bank, and telecom indices fell by 0.5% each, while pharma, media, oil & gas, auto, and consumer durable gained between 0.3% and 1%.
BSE Midcap index ended flat and smallcap index rose 0.5%.

Prediction for Monday NIFTY can go up if it goes above 25,600 or down after the level of 25,000, but it also depends upon the Global cues.
NIFTY ended the July 4 session on a positive note, closing above the 25,450 mark despite market volatility. The daily chart displays a hammer candlestick pattern, often seen as a sign of a bullish reversal. On the upside, resistance is placed at 25,600 and 26,000, while on the downside, support levels are seen between 25,000 and 24,500.
